Lorton is a village located in Otoe County, Nebraska. Lorton has a 2025 population of 38 . Lorton is currently declining at a rate of 0% annually and its population has increased by 8.57%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 35 in 2020.
The average household income in Lorton is $70,221 with a poverty rate of 19.64%. The median age in Lorton is 54.7 years: 49.5 years for males, and 54.7 years for females. For every 100 females there are 60.0 males.
